Kakilang: Home X

Dance performance meets cutting edge technology in this live show combining theatre, music, gaming and VR technology created with artists in London and Hong Kong.

Mythological yet futuristic, HOME X is a visually stunning virtual world connecting performers in Hong Kong and Cambridge in real-time using depth-sensing cameras which capture 3D video.

Exploring themes of roots and belonging, destruction and renewal, this ground-breaking experimental performance features live music, dance and moving real-life testimony of home and migration. Audiences can discover a virtual land inhabited by magical creatures through a panoramic 270-degree projection.

Featuring an original live electronic music score by An-Ting 安婷 in the UK, with opera singer Colette Lam performing soprano in Hong Kong, and live break dance by choreographers Si Rawlinson in the UK and Suen Nam in Hong Kong.

HOME X is co-produced by Kakilang and their Hong Kong partner, Don’t Believe in Style.
